What you will do

Under general supervision oversees required day-to-day activities of field technician team and plans monthly technician routes. Analyzes team performance and recommends changes to ensure profitability, safety, and client satisfaction. Maintains customer satisfaction while balancing financial goals. Ensures safety compliance.

How you will do it

Supervises and provides leadership for assigned Teams. Ensure developmental plans are in place.

Leads the execution efforts of assigned business. Ensures consistency of delivery systems. Monitors and supervises the business plans.

Coordinates the team’s work with sales to ensure all sales opportunities are supported including linkage to installation opportunities.

Raises potential market opportunities to the attention of the appropriate branch or region resource for strategic direction.

Ensures that serviced account portfolios achieve growth, proper profit levels and customer satisfaction.

Recommends and supports staffing requirements for the assigned business.

Serves as a communication channel to share the standard process strategies and results enables SSNA vision.

Implements plans to comply, and monitors standards for HVAC operations. Audits the effectiveness of operations and makes changes to improve performance.

Ensures that contractual obligations are completed, and customer satisfaction is achieved.

Drives service and installation operational review meetings, reviewing bids and estimates for accuracy.

Effectively applies branch workforce and management and deployment of overall resources.

Analyzes operations processes and provides recommendations for improvements.

Implements other managerial responsibilities, i.e., performance reviews and acquisitions consistent with established business strategy.

Recruits, hires and retains operational staff. Prepares and delivers clear performance expectations, performance reviews, and development plans for direct reports teaming with the appropriate matrix functional manager. Ensures a consistent level of coaching, which includes monthly one on one(s), operational and financial reviews.

Works with team leaders to ensure proper workforce and skill levels for the successful and profitable execution of the business.

Performs other duties related to customer satisfaction, deployment of pivotal initiatives to teams, development and maintenance of team business plans and account management of service customers.

What we look for

Required

  • A minimum of five (5) years of progressive operational experience in HVAC services.

  • Three (3) years of experience in management role with responsibility for the productivity and development of others.

Preferred

  • Bachelor’s degree in Engineering or Business or equivalent working experience.

  • Johnson Controls Metasys experience

  • Eight (8) years’ experience in an operational HVAC role with leadership responsibilities

  • Six Sigma Green Belt
